Japan Top 30 Singles Oct 25 2009

in Japan’s top 30 singles this week, Japanese group’s B’z has 2 singles in the top 30 Ichibu to Zenbu / Dive” and “my lonely town” holding the number one spot on the Oricon Jpop charts. Other notables in the chart are SCANDAL – “Yumemiru Tsubasa”, YUI – “It’s all too much/Never say die” and Sukima Switch – “Golden Time Lover” at number 2.
30- Tokyo Ska Paradise Orchestra – “KinouKyouAshita”
29- Kotomi Maki – “Mujou no Ame ga Furu”
28- UNCHAIN – “Gravity”
27- Ryu Si Won – “Memu”
26- Chuji Mikado – “Naniwagawa”
25- Ryuuko Mizuta – “Ine no Funaya”
24- Keisuke Yamauchi – “Fuurenko”
23- TOKYO No.1 SOUL SET + HALCALI – “Konya wa Boogie Back”
22- Nami Tamaki – “Moshimo Negai ga…”
21- Toko Furuuchi X KREVA – “A to XYZ / Slowbeat”
20- The Cro-Magnons – “Glycerin Queen”
19- JEJUNG & YUCHUN(from Tohoshinki) – “COLORS~Melody and Harmony~/Shelter”
18- THE ALFEE – “Yoake wo Motomete”
17- Kiyoshi Hikawa – “Tokimeki no Rumba”
16- RHYMESTER – “ONCE AGAIN”
15- JAY’ED – “Everybody”
14- SCANDAL – “Yumemiru Tsubasa”
13- Unicorn – “Hanseiki Shonen”
12- B’z – “Ichibu to Zenzu / DIVE”
11- the GazettE – “BEFORE I DECAY”
10- Mari Iijima, FIRE BOMBER, May’n – “Macross Gannen Kinen Chojiku Anthem : Iki wo Shiteiru Kanjiteiru”
9- Hilcrhyme – “Shunkashuto”
8- The Birthday – “Ai de Nuri Tsubuse”
7- Ikimonogakari – “YELL / Joyful”
6- Shoko Nakagawa – “Arigato no Egao”
5- Gospellers – “Love Notes”
4- Shinsengumi Rian – “Otokomichi”
3- YUI – “It’s all too much/Never say die”
2- Sukima Switch – “Golden Time Lover”
1- B’z – “MY LONELY TOWN”
